How they compare
Belgium currently reports 0.979 against 0.7886 in Kyrgyzstan, a difference of 0.1904.
That makes Belgium's figure about 1.2 times Kyrgyzstan's.
Across all 173 years both countries report, Belgium has been ahead every year.
Belgium ranks 42nd and Kyrgyzstan ranks 45th of 179 countries.
Belgium has averaged higher in every one of the 19 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belgium | Kyrgyzstan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1830s | 1.31 | 0.0002 | 1.31 | Belgium |
| 1850s | 2.82 | 0.0028 | 2.81 | Belgium |
| 1860s | 3.81 | 0.0117 | 3.8 | Belgium |
| 1870s | 4.94 | 0.0441 | 4.9 | Belgium |
| 1880s | 5.78 | 0.0826 | 5.69 | Belgium |
| 1890s | 6.44 | 0.1417 | 6.29 | Belgium |
| 1900s | 7.52 | 0.2729 | 7.24 | Belgium |
| 1910s | 6.55 | 0.3095 | 6.24 | Belgium |
| 1920s | 9.35 | 0.1844 | 9.17 | Belgium |
| 1930s | 9.12 | 0.7932 | 8.33 | Belgium |
| 1940s | 7.05 | 1.09 | 5.96 | Belgium |
| 1950s | 8.31 | 2.2 | 6.11 | Belgium |
| 1960s | 6.75 | 2.38 | 4.38 | Belgium |
| 1970s | 4.47 | 2.3 | 2.17 | Belgium |
| 1980s | 4.09 | 2.16 | 1.93 | Belgium |
| 1990s | 3.56 | 0.709 | 2.85 | Belgium |
| 2000s | 2.47 | 0.4327 | 2.03 | Belgium |
| 2010s | 1.31 | 0.605 | 0.7041 | Belgium |
| 2020s | 0.9631 | 0.6723 | 0.2907 | Belgium |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
